Frequently Asked Questions about Windsor Hills
How much are Studio apartments in Windsor Hills?
There are currently 1,446 Studio Apartments in Windsor Hills with rent ranges from $1,195 to $3,850 with an average price of $2,091.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Windsor Hills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Windsor Hills ranges from $1,498 to $8,480 with an average monthly rent of $2,988.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Windsor Hills c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Windsor Hills range from $1,995 to $13,007.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,286.
How expensive are Windsor Hills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 537 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Windsor Hills on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,295 to $6,285 - averaging $3,817 for the location.
